Samantha Lore

Advocacy Fellow

Samantha Lore joined the Fulbright team for the 2023 advocacy season. She is a proud Fulbright alumna to Italy from 2019-2020. There, she taught six high school classes and incorporated lessons about food waste. Currently, Samantha serves the Fulbright community by organizing the spring advocacy campaigns, including chapter-based constituent meetings, and Advocacy Day on Capitol Hill on April 20, 2023. Prior to this role Samantha served as a Research Assistant in the School of International Service at American University and as a Legal Research Associate with the Public International Law and Policy Group. Samantha is currently receiving her Master’s Degree in International Development from American University. She also holds a Bachelor’s Degree in Environmental Studies from Siena College.
